Output 95114ea7259a5f1614fd7a5c9318180372b73b501e02a6197a7d4783f866288c:49

value
53671157
script pubkey
OP_HASH160 OP_PUSHBYTES_20 19522429eb189b4e3889a2683e5e0db15504b1b9 OP_EQUAL
address
MAD3XW1rPCxeiVQVtShCgP4TQJ3a25LhZH
transaction
95114ea7259a5f1614fd7a5c9318180372b73b501e02a6197a7d4783f866288c
spent
true